§ 968.225   Budget revisions.

(a) A PHA shall not incur any modernization cost in excess of the total HUD-approved CIAP budget. A PHA shall submit a budget revision, in a form prescribed by HUD, if the PHA plans to deviate from the originally approved modernization program, as it was competitively funded, by deleting or substantially revising approved work items or adding new work items that are unrelated to the originally approved modernization program, or to change the method of accomplishment from contract to force account labor, except as provided in paragraph (b)(4) of this section.

(b) In addition to the requirements of paragraph (a) of this section, a PHA shall comply with the following requirements:

(1) A PHA is not required to obtain prior HUD approval if, in order to complete the originally approved modernization program, the PHA needs to delete or revise approved work items or add new related work items consistent with the original modernization program. In such case, a PHA shall certify that the revisions are necessary to carry out the approved work and do not result in substantial changes to the competitively funded modernization program.

(2) A PHA shall not incur any modernization cost on behalf of any development that is not covered by the original CIAP application.

(3) Where there are funds leftover after completion of the originally approved modernization program, a PHA may, without prior HUD approval, use the remaining funds to carry out eligible modernization activities at developments covered by the original CIAP application.

(4) If a PHA is both an overall high performer and a modernization high performer under the Public Housing Management Assessment Program (PHMAP), the PHA is not required to obtain prior HUD approval to change the method of accomplishment from contract to force account labor.
